Output 6520d0f7dfb564c5158d91fd407d561bbfa35e8392c4a14b56a397ad9bb4e55d:1

value
4931201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f4a0a08de532c5720ac381ee8c11a6a60a3fb3 OP_EQUAL
address
3EuUHBRYvRJBzhEHtynadmqtQSXkXPeTP1
transaction
6520d0f7dfb564c5158d91fd407d561bbfa35e8392c4a14b56a397ad9bb4e55d
spent
true